Translators, like interpreters, enable communication across cultures by translating one language into another. Translators work with written text, as opposed to spoken word.
Translating involves much more than simple word-for-word conversion from one language to another. Translators must thoroughly understand the subject matter of any text they translate, as well as the cultures associated with the source and target language.
